全面技术项目源码集合:ECND网络硬盘v0.1.0 beta版

版权申诉
0 下载量 9 浏览量 更新于2024-11-21 收藏 14KB RAR 举报
资源摘要信息:"基于HTML实现上传下载网站_ECND网络硬盘 v0.1.0 beta_ecnd(HTML源码+数据集+项目使用说明).rar" 知识点一:HTML基础与应用 HTML(超文本标记语言)是构建网站的骨架,用于创建网页和网络应用。本资源中提及的ECND网络硬盘项目将涉及HTML的使用,包括但不限于表单标签、链接、图片、脚本的嵌入等,确保网站能够实现基本的上传和下载功能。 知识点二:前端开发技术 前端开发技术涉及客户端界面的实现,包括HTML、CSS和JavaScript的综合运用。资源中提到的项目将展示如何通过前端技术与用户交互,实现网络硬盘的用户界面设计和用户体验优化。 知识点三:后端开发基础 后端开发涉及服务器端的逻辑处理,数据库管理以及应用的运行逻辑。本资源中包含的网络硬盘项目将涉及后端技术的实现,如PHP、Python、Java等后端语言的使用,以及如何与前端进行数据交互。 知识点四:数据库应用 数据库技术用于存储、检索和管理数据。在ECND网络硬盘项目中,可能需要使用MySQL、SQLite或其他类型的数据库来存储用户数据和文件信息。了解数据库的结构设计、SQL语句的使用等知识将对项目开发至关重要。 知识点五:操作系统原理 资源中提到的操作系统为网络硬盘项目提供了运行环境。了解Linux、Windows等操作系统的原理,尤其是文件系统管理和网络通信接口,对于开发一个稳定且高效的网络硬盘服务是必不可少的。 知识点六:移动开发 移动开发关注于移动设备上的应用开发。资源列表虽然没有直接提及,但在网络硬盘项目中,可能会涉及到响应式设计或特定的移动应用开发,以提供在手机和平板电脑上的良好用户体验。 知识点七:信息化管理与大数据 网络硬盘项目在数据存储与管理方面,将体现信息化管理知识。随着数据量的增长,大数据的概念也被引入,涉及数据的收集、处理、存储、分析和可视化等技术。 知识点八:物联网、EDA、Proteus与RTOS 资源中提及了物联网、EDA(电子设计自动化)、Proteus和RTOS(实时操作系统),这些通常与嵌入式系统或特定的硬件开发相关。虽然与网络硬盘直接关系不大,但在项目中可能会涉及一些硬件控制或模拟。 知识点九:多种编程语言的应用 项目使用说明中提到了多种编程语言,包括STM32、ESP8266、PHP、QT、Linux、iOS、C++、Java、python、web、C#等。这些语言和平台将在项目中扮演不同的角色,从后端逻辑处理到前端界面设计,再到可能的移动端应用开发。 知识点十:项目测试与质量保证 资源中强调所有源码都经过严格测试,能直接运行。这说明项目在开发过程中有完整的测试计划和测试用例,以确保功能的正确性。对于学习者而言,了解如何进行有效的软件测试,对提高代码质量、保证项目成功至关重要。 知识点十一:技术学习与项目借鉴 资源适合不同技术水平的学习者,尤其适合那些希望学习和深入不同技术领域的人。项目不仅可以作为学习材料,还可以作为毕业设计、课程设计、大作业等。此外,资源鼓励学习者在现有基础上进行修改和功能扩展。 知识点十二:沟通与学习社群 最后,资源提供者鼓励学习者下载使用,并在使用过程中遇到问题时,及时与博主沟通。这一点强调了学习过程中互动和社群支持的重要性,通过与他人交流可以快速学习和解决问题。